Grant Description

The Fund for Bogalusa Grant is offered by the Northshore Community Foundation, a private nonprofit foundation based in Covington, Louisiana. The Fund for Bogalusa was created to support the changing human service and economic development needs of the Bogalusa area. Through partnerships with local nonprofit organizations, the fund aims to build stronger communities by leveraging local talents and resources to address community challenges. The fund supports projects that align with the community’s greatest opportunities, focusing on both economic development and human services. Nonprofit organizations applying for this grant must clearly demonstrate that their proposed projects have been thoughtfully planned to address these priorities. Eligible uses of the grant include any project that contributes to building the community in meaningful and measurable ways. Eligible applicants must be tax-exempt under Section 501(c)(3) of the Internal Revenue Code. Additionally, all funded projects must be implemented within the Bogalusa area. Organizations receiving funding will be required to submit both fiscal accounting and narrative reports detailing how the funds were used and the outcomes achieved. These reporting guidelines will be outlined in the letter of award. The current application window runs from June 3 through July 2, 2025, with grant awards announced on August 15, 2025. The fund does not operate on a rolling basis but is expected to recur annually. The maximum grant award available per project is $5,000. There is no required matching contribution. Applications must be fully completed and submitted by the deadline. While no specific pre-application deadlines, question periods, or mandatory application questions are listed, applicants should ensure thorough and thoughtful responses.
